How to fill out the Vermont In 111 2011 Form online
Completing the Vermont In 111 2011 Form online is a straightforward process that can help individuals file their income tax returns efficiently. This guide provides step-by-step instructions to ensure users can successfully navigate each section of the form.
Follow the steps to fill out the Vermont In 111 2011 Form online.
- Press the 'Get Form' button to obtain the Vermont In 111 2011 Form and open it in your online editor.
- Begin by entering your taxpayer information in the designated fields. This includes your Social Security number, last name, and first name. If you are filing jointly, be sure to fill in your spouse or civil union partner's information as well.
- Input your mailing address, including the number and street/road or PO Box, city or town, state, and zip code.
- Indicate your filing status by checking the appropriate box. Options include single, married filing jointly, married filing separately, head of household, or qualifying widow(er) with dependent children.
- In the exemptions section, provide details as required from the Federal Form 1040 or its corresponding lines.
- For the income section, follow the instructions to calculate your Adjusted Gross Income and other relevant figures as denoted in the form.
- Complete the tax calculation section by filling in all necessary tax-related fields as per your income details.
- If applicable, provide details about any credits or use taxes in the designated sections.
- Review your entries to ensure accuracy and completeness, checking for any errors or missing information.
- Once all sections are completed, save your changes, and you may then choose to download, print, or share the filled form as needed.

The non-resident withholding tax in Vermont applies to certain payments made to non-residents, ensuring that any income generated in the state is taxed accordingly. This tax is often withheld from payments such as salaries and contract work. Understanding this tax is vital for proper compliance.
